No...you need to read the article I linked you to.

 

You need to establish what the monthly repayment to wards the PPI part of the loan was.

 

You then list each and every one of one of those repayments into the spreadsheet, one under the other.

 

How long was the loan for?

 

Was it fixed rate or variable?

 

Did you make all payments on time and did the loan run its full term?

Ok so you need to list 60 payments of £206.23 in the spreadsheet giving the date of the payments. Set the "Claim to" date on the spreadsheet to today's date if it isn't already set.

 

When you have listed the 60 repayments of £206.23 the sheet will then give you the figures of what you could expect back.
